Traditional Roof
With all the roofing design and styles that you can select in the market today, you most likely require a little aid to press you to the right instructions. Proper preparation and substantial time should be set aside in choosing the ideal roof design that would best fit your home. roofings considerably contribute to the look you want your home to depict.
In considering timeless roofing designs, you'll possibly find the variety almost limitless. Timeless roofing often requires a significant amount of craftsmanship and knowledge. That is why aside from picking premium grade products, it is similarly important to work with just the finest roof professionals in your area.
Often, the usage recycled roof materials are completely proper to assist you in accomplishing the classic roof style to want to pull off. It is likewise advisable to utilize the lightweight, artificial items if you like the standard, traditional roofing design.
There are steel tiles which are designed to look like traditional roofing tile but with the benefit of much easier setup and substantially cheaper too. The artificial timeless roof will not only offer you the defense and coverage versus harsh weather condition conditions, you can confidently anticipate it to last longer than the basic cedar or slate roofs.
There are lots of newer slates and replica shakes that are really filled with rubber compounds, making it capable to much better prevent the damaging UV rays, and more resilient and fire resistant. Synthetic products are especially a lot easier to install utilizing air pressured nail guns.
Be sure to examine the advantages of every option when initially choosing the style of roofing to wish to adjust. Choose which style that will best enhance the appeal of your home, and would still use the sturdiness that you need.

Flat Roofs
Flat roofings are a fantastic way to keep a structure safe from water. Knowing exactly what to do with a flat roof will ensure you have a working roof system that will last a long time.
They may look excellent, and are very common, flat roofings do require regular upkeep and comprehensive repair work in order to successfully avoid water infiltration. You'll be happy with your flat roof for a really long time if this is done correctly.
Flat roofings aren't as popular and/or attractive as its newer equivalents, such as tile, copper, or slate roofs. They are simply as essential and need even more attention. In order to prevent throwing away cash on short-term repairs, you should understand exactly how flat roofing system systems are designed, the numerous types of flat roofings that are readily available, and the significance of regular inspection and maintenance.
A flat roof system works by offering a waterproof membrane over a building. It consists of several layers of hydrophobic products that is positioned over a structural deck with a vapor barrier that is typically positioned in between the roof and the deck membrane.
Flashing, or thin strips of product such as copper, intersect with the membrane and the other structure parts to avoid water seepage. The water is then directed to drains pipes, downspouts, and seamless gutters by the roofing system's small pitch.
There are 4 most common kinds of flat roofing system systems. Noted in order of increasing durability and cost, they are: roll asphalt, single-ply membrane, built-up or multiple-ply, and flat-seamed metal. They can vary anywhere from as low as $2 per square foot for roll asphalt or single-ply roof that is used over and existing roof, to $20 per square foot or more for brand-new metal roofs.
Used given that the 1890s, asphalt roll roofing generally includes one layer of asphalt-saturated natural or fiberglass base felts that are used over roofing felt with nails and cold asphalt cement and typically covered with a granular mineral surface. The joints are usually covered over with a roofing compound. It can last about 10 years.
Single-ply membrane roof is the most recent type of roof product. It is frequently utilized to replace multiple-ply roofing systems. 10 to 12 year service warranties are common, however proper installation is crucial and maintenance is still needed.
Multiple-ply or built-up roofing, also known as BUR, is made from overlapping rolls of saturated or layered felts or mats that are interspersed with layers of bitumen and appeared with a granular roof sheet, tile, or ballast pavers that are used to protect the underlying products from the weather. BURs are designed to last 10 to 30 years, which depends on the products used.
Ballast, or aggregate, of crushed stone or water-worn gravel is embedded in a coating of asphalt or coal tar. Given that the ballast or tile pavers cover the membrane, it makes inspecting and preserving the seams of the roofing system difficult.
Finally, flat-seamed roofs have actually been used since the 19 th century. Made from little pieces of sheet metal soldered flush at the joints, it can last many decades depending on the quality of the direct exposure, material, and upkeep to the components.
Galvanized metal does need routine painting in order to prevent corrosion and split joints need to be resoldered. Other metal surfaces, such as copper, can become pitted and pinholed from acid raid and normally needs replacing. Today copper, lead-coated copper, and terne-coated stainless steel are favored as long-lasting flat roofings.
